Q. The colour codes of a carbon resistor are yellow, yellow, orange. Tolerance is 5%. Find the resistance.
The initial yellow ring corresponds to 4. The subsequent yellow ring corresponds to 4 and the third orange ring corresponds to 103. Tolerance is 5%. The resistance value is 44 X 103 ± 5% or else 44 KΩ ± 5%

The energy possessed by a object by virtue of its position or its configuration is called its potential energy. Concept of potential energy is valid only in conservative field.
